Best Screws For Not Rusting at Albert Stallworth blog

Best Screws For Not Rusting. (brass screws, shown second from left, also work outdoors, but will tarnish and aren’t as strong as silicon bronze.) The best screw materials for resistance to rust and corrosion are silicon bronze and stainless steel. The stainless steel screw will absolutely be the best screw to resist rust.
